From 4c81cef75d7871e2c77d6723813ac328c34603b5 Mon Sep 17 00:00:00 2001 From: Michael Widenius Date: Thu, 12 May 2011 02:19:28 +0300 Subject: Fixed bug when accessing wrong decimal value in dynamic string (Fixed lp:781233) Store decimal 0.0 in zero bytes in dynamic strings. mysqltest: Don't ignore error from mysql_stmt_fetch; This could cause rows to be missing from log when running with --ps-protocol Fixed wrong result length for CAST(... as TIME) client/mysqltest.cc: Don't ignore error from mysql_stmt_fetch; This could cause rows to be missing from log when running with --ps-protocol libmysql/libmysql.c: The max length for a TIME column is 17, not 15. mysql-test/r/dyncol.result: More tests mysql-test/t/dyncol.test: More tests mysys/ma_dyncol.c: Check content of decimal value on read and store to not get assert in decimal_bin_size(). Store decimal 0.0 in zero bytes in dynamic strings. This also solves a problem where decimal 0 had different internal representations. sql-common/my_time.c: Fixed DBUG_PRINT sql/item_timefunc.h: Fixed wrong result length for CAST(... as TIME).
